Output 75301517836394d53c1c37c5cc5427515e72e23eb24dde8ce72a18e585c3e917:1

value
2158726
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2e73d38b605754cc34554ebe8c0ae6504ce2249 OP_EQUALVERIFY OP_CHECKSIG
address
1Mgkj8cXMyWY1qhXMAAs5QDGfqrpZmktFu
transaction
75301517836394d53c1c37c5cc5427515e72e23eb24dde8ce72a18e585c3e917
spent
true